LHACM

Version Home Assistant Providers License

Local Home Assistant Component Manager (LHACM) is a Home Assistant custom integration for managing custom components from self-hosted or remote GitLab and Gitea repositories.

LHACM is intended to follow the HACS user model while replacing the GitHub-only repository backend with GitLab and Gitea support.

Current scope

Version 1.0.0 establishes the integration foundation:

  • HACS-style Home Assistant config flow with no repository host URL in setup.
  • Home Assistant sidebar panel with a HACS-style repository dashboard.
  • Custom repositories dialog for adding GitLab and Gitea repository URLs by type.
  • GitLab and Gitea provider clients.
  • Repository metadata, tree, release, archive, and raw-file helpers.
  • Services to add and install custom repositories from repository URLs.
  • Install, update, uninstall, remove, and refresh lifecycle actions.
  • Native Home Assistant update entities for installed repositories.
  • Safe ZIP extraction into Home Assistant custom component paths.

Full HACS parity is the target. The next major areas are repository indexes from local GitLab/Gitea systems, background queues, repair flows, and richer validation.

Installation

Copy custom_components/lhacm into your Home Assistant custom_components directory and restart Home Assistant.

Configuration

Add the integration from Settings > Devices & services > Add integration > LHACM.

Setup does not ask for GitLab or Gitea URLs. Repository locations are supplied when adding a custom repository, matching the HACS flow.

For private repositories, set an environment variable for the repository host:

LHACM_TOKEN_GITLAB_EXAMPLE_COM

Services

lhacm.add_repository

Registers and validates a repository.

Example repository value:

https://gitlab.example.com/group/custom-integration

lhacm.install_repository

Downloads a repository archive and installs it into the target Home Assistant custom location.

Repository layout

For Home Assistant integrations, LHACM expects one of these layouts:

  • custom_components/<domain>/manifest.json
  • <domain>/manifest.json
  • manifest.json in repository root

The installed integration is copied to custom_components/<domain>.
